A free online tool called Spotify Pie shows the musical genres you’ve listened to the most on a vibrant pie chart. Not only that, the website also features a list of your top performers for the current. How to Find Your Spotify Pie Chart

Method 1: Via Mobile
Follow the steps mentioned below to see your Spotify pie chart from your phone:
Note: We do not endorse the use of third-party apps as they may expose your device to unwanted malware or viruses. User discretion is advised.
- Visit the official website of Spotify Pie Chart.
- Swipe down and tap on Bake Spotify Pie Chart under Spotify Pie Chart.
- Log in to your account using your credentials.
- Tap on Agree under Allow Spotify to connect to Music Pie Chart.
- Tap on See Spotify Pie Chart under Your Spotify Pie Chart is ready!
Now your pie chart showing your listening history will be ready to view and share.
Method 2: Via Desktop
You can also see the Spotify Pie Chart from your PC. Here’s how:
- Visit the official Spotify Pie Chart web page.
- Scroll down and click on Login with Spotify.
- Enter your login credentials.
- Click on See Spotify Pie Chart under Your Spotify Pie Chart is ready!
This way your pie chart will be created by taking your Spotify history.
Is the Spotify Pie Chart an Official Spotify Feature?
No, the Spotify Pie Chart is not an official feature provided by Spotify. It is typically created using third-party tools or websites.
Can You Customize Your Spotify Pie Chart?
No, you cannot customize the time frames or adjust the visual appearance of your songs based on the Spotify Pie Chart result.
